Why did I put these ingredients in my cereal? These are just my favourite though you can add almost anything your heart desires.
Sesame seeds: High plant source of calcium for healthy bones and teeth
Sunflower seeds: Helps lower cholesterol
Goji berries: Strong antioxidant to fight cancers and other diseases
Buckwheat Kernels: Easily digested and low GI
Ingredients
1 cup puffed rice
1 cup puffed quinoa
1/2 cup sunflower seeds
1/2 cup sesame seeds
1/2 cup goji berries
3 tbsp chia seeds
Directions
1. Place everything into a jar and shake until it’s all mixed up
2. Top with your favourites and enjoy!
Toppings
Coconut yogurt
Fresh figs
Banana
Cinnamon
Fresh mango
